Table 19. Peripheral Configuration Submenu (continued)

Feature Options Description

Mode

• Output only
Bi-directional (default)
• EPP
• ECP

Selects the mode for the parallel port. Not available
if the parallel port is disabled.

Output Only operates in AT*-compatible mode.

Bi-directional operates in PS/2-compatible mode.

EPP is Extended Parallel Port mode, a high-speed
bi-directional mode.

ECP is Enhanced Capabilities Port mode, a high-
speed bi-directional mode.

Base I/O Address
(This feature is present
only when Parallel Port
is set to Enabled)

378 (default)
• 278

Specifies the base I/O address for the parallel port,
if Parallel Port is Enabled.

Interrupt
(This feature is present
only when Parallel Port
is set to Enabled)

• IRQ 5
IRQ 7 (default)

Specifies the interrupt for the parallel port, if Parallel
Port is Enabled.
